Performance notes
Without confirmed ingredient data, specific performance claims cannot be made. Cosrx products in adjacent categories often use BHA (salicylic acid) or AHA (lactic, glycolic) actives alongside soothing agents. If this peel follows that pattern, buyers can reasonably expect a measured exfoliation approach. Checking the full ingredient list on arrival and doing a patch test remain good practices.

Is this suitable for sensitive skin?
Cosrx generally formulates with sensitive skin in mind, avoiding common irritants like fragrance and harsh surfactants across much of their range. However, without knowing the actives and concentrations in this particular product, it is not possible to confirm sensitivity suitability. Patch testing before full-face use is always the right first step with any new exfoliant.
